4K with a Series X is a big deal and completely worth it. In many ways, you’re shortchanging yourself on the entire point of the step up from the earlier Xbox One. The biggest improvements with the Series X is 4K and fast loading times. You’re only getting the latter with a 1080p display.

I see a massive difference in visual fidelity when I use the Xbox on 4K vs. the PC on 1080p. The cockpit detail with labels and instrumentation is a major upgrade on 4K.

Regarding the 60Hz vs. 120Hz. If you’re only using the Xbox for MSFS, then the 120Hz is really not something that is essential or needed. My 28" 4K display is 60Hz. I have another Series X connected to a 55" 4K 120Hz display that is used for gaming, and it makes better use of that 120Hz. The Series X connected to the 60Hz display only has MSFS installed on it. MSFS doesn’t really benefit from the kinds of framerate boosts that a fast-paced shooter-type game does.
